Compassion Quote by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art
“God is ever before my eyes. I realize his omnipotence and I fear His anger; but I also recognize his compassion, and His tenderness towards His creatures.”
About This Quote
Divine presence is perceived as both awe‑inspiring power and compassionate tenderness, reflecting a dual view of God as both judge and caretaker.
In simple terms: God is both mighty and merciful.
Divine nature blends authority with compassion.
